Key West is a city on the island of Key West, that is about four miles long by two miles wide. Until 1912 it was very isolated, when Henry Flagler’s Florida East Coast Railway (FEC) had its opening. The Labor Day hurricane of 1935 destroyed the railroad, and the FEC determined not to reconstruct it. The U.S. government at that time rebuilt the route as a highway, opening it in 1938 as an extension of U.S. Highway 1.

1. Fishing. You can have an excellent deep-sea fishing experience, as there are several private boats in addition to party boats to use. Flats’ fishing is also very popular at the Florida Keys. It involves no unique equipment or skill-set. You do not even need a boat. Just wade out in shallow water and then cast a line, and you are able to catch bonefish and tarpon, along with other fish which are routinely found in water that isn’t deep. You are not going to catch any prize fish, but there will be fish in those shallow waters. Or many decide to use a flatbed skiff.
